/third_party/mesa3d/include/GL/internal/ |
D | dri_interface.h | 61 typedef struct __DRIscreenRec __DRIscreen; typedef 176 int (*getDrawableMSC)(__DRIscreen *screen, __DRIdrawable *drawable, 317 void (*set_cache_funcs) (__DRIscreen *screen, 351 void *(*get_fence_from_cl_event)(__DRIscreen *screen, intptr_t cl_event); 356 void (*destroy_fence)(__DRIscreen *screen, void *fence); 390 unsigned (*get_capabilities)(__DRIscreen *screen); 417 int (*get_fence_fd)(__DRIscreen *screen, void *fence); 807 __DRIscreen *(*createNewScreen)(int screen, int fd, 813 void (*destroyScreen)(__DRIscreen *screen); 815 const __DRIextension **(*getExtensions)(__DRIscreen *screen); [all …]
|
/third_party/mesa3d/src/mesa/drivers/dri/common/ |
D | dri_util.h | 121 const __DRIconfig **(*InitScreen) (__DRIscreen * priv); 123 void (*DestroyScreen)(__DRIscreen *driScrnPriv); 134 GLboolean (*CreateBuffer)(__DRIscreen *driScrnPriv, 149 __DRIbuffer *(*AllocateBuffer) (__DRIscreen *screenPrivate, 154 void (*ReleaseBuffer) (__DRIscreen *screenPrivate, __DRIbuffer *buffer); 256 __DRIscreen *driScreenPriv; 289 __DRIscreen *driScreenPriv;
|
D | dri_util.c | 71 setupLoaderExtensions(__DRIscreen *psp, in setupLoaderExtensions() 118 static __DRIscreen * 125 __DRIscreen *psp; in driCreateNewScreen2() 196 static __DRIscreen * 206 static __DRIscreen * 214 static __DRIscreen * 230 static void driDestroyScreen(__DRIscreen *psp) in driDestroyScreen() 247 static const __DRIextension **driGetExtensions(__DRIscreen *psp) in driGetExtensions() 256 validate_context_version(__DRIscreen *screen, in validate_context_version() 300 driCreateContextAttribs(__DRIscreen *screen, int api, in driCreateContextAttribs() [all …]
|
D | utils.h | 61 driQueryRendererIntegerCommon(__DRIscreen *psp, int param, unsigned int *value);
|
/third_party/mesa3d/src/loader/ |
D | loader_dri3_helper.h | 112 __DRIscreen *(*get_dri_screen)(void); 134 __DRIscreen *dri_screen; 140 __DRIscreen *dri_screen_display_gpu; 205 __DRIscreen *dri_screen, 263 __DRIscreen *dri_screen, 272 __DRIscreen *dri_screen, 291 loader_dri3_close_screen(__DRIscreen *dri_screen);
|
D | loader_dri_helper.h | 27 __DRIimage *loader_dri_create_image(__DRIscreen *screen,
|
/third_party/mesa3d/src/gallium/frontends/dri/ |
D | dri_screen.h | 59 __DRIscreen *sPriv; 104 dri_screen(__DRIscreen * sPriv) in dri_screen() 131 __DRIscreen *sPriv; 135 dri_with_format(__DRIscreen * sPriv) in dri_with_format() 160 dri_destroy_screen(__DRIscreen * sPriv);
|
D | drisw.c | 49 __DRIscreen *sPriv = dPriv->driScreenPriv; in get_drawable_info() 60 __DRIscreen *sPriv = dPriv->driScreenPriv; in put_image() 72 __DRIscreen *sPriv = dPriv->driScreenPriv; in put_image2() 85 __DRIscreen *sPriv = dPriv->driScreenPriv; in put_image_shm() 102 __DRIscreen *sPriv = dPriv->driScreenPriv; in get_image() 113 __DRIscreen *sPriv = dPriv->driScreenPriv; in get_image2() 129 __DRIscreen *sPriv = dPriv->driScreenPriv; in get_image_shm() 500 drisw_init_screen(__DRIscreen * sPriv) in drisw_init_screen() 563 drisw_create_buffer(__DRIscreen * sPriv, in drisw_create_buffer()
|
D | dri2.c | 218 __DRIscreen *sPriv = drawable->sPriv; in dri_image_drawable_get_buffers() 290 dri2_allocate_buffer(__DRIscreen *sPriv, in dri2_allocate_buffer() 382 dri2_release_buffer(__DRIscreen *sPriv, __DRIbuffer *bPriv) in dri2_release_buffer() 400 __DRIscreen *sPriv = drawable->sPriv; in dri2_allocate_textures() 801 dri2_create_image_from_winsys(__DRIscreen *_screen, in dri2_create_image_from_winsys() 939 dri2_create_image_from_name(__DRIscreen *_screen, in dri2_create_image_from_name() 972 dri2_get_modifier_num_planes(__DRIscreen *_screen, in dri2_get_modifier_num_planes() 1003 dri2_create_image_from_fd(__DRIscreen *_screen, in dri2_create_image_from_fd() 1064 dri2_create_image_common(__DRIscreen *_screen, in dri2_create_image_common() 1147 dri2_create_image(__DRIscreen *_screen, in dri2_create_image() [all …]
|
D | dri_context.h | 48 __DRIscreen *sPriv; 89 dri_get_current(__DRIscreen * driScreenPriv);
|
D | dri_drawable.h | 48 __DRIscreen *sPriv; 95 dri_create_buffer(__DRIscreen * sPriv,
|
D | dri_query_renderer.c | 12 dri2_query_renderer_integer(__DRIscreen *_screen, int param, in dri2_query_renderer_integer() 88 dri2_query_renderer_string(__DRIscreen *_screen, int param, in dri2_query_renderer_string()
|
D | dri_helpers.c | 79 static unsigned dri2_fence_get_caps(__DRIscreen *_screen) in dri2_fence_get_caps() 135 dri2_get_fence_fd(__DRIscreen *_screen, void *_fence) in dri2_get_fence_fd() 145 dri2_get_fence_from_cl_event(__DRIscreen *_screen, intptr_t cl_event) in dri2_get_fence_from_cl_event() 169 dri2_destroy_fence(__DRIscreen *_screen, void *_fence) in dri2_destroy_fence() 677 dri2_query_dma_buf_formats(__DRIscreen *_screen, int max, int *formats, in dri2_query_dma_buf_formats()
|
/third_party/mesa3d/src/mesa/drivers/dri/nouveau/ |
D | nouveau_screen.c | 50 nouveau_destroy_screen(__DRIscreen *dri_screen); 92 nouveau_init_screen2(__DRIscreen *dri_screen) in nouveau_init_screen2() 160 nouveau_query_renderer_integer(__DRIscreen *psp, int param, in nouveau_query_renderer_integer() 198 nouveau_query_renderer_string(__DRIscreen *psp, int param, const char **value) in nouveau_query_renderer_string() 223 nouveau_destroy_screen(__DRIscreen *dri_screen) in nouveau_destroy_screen() 238 nouveau_create_buffer(__DRIscreen *dri_screen, in nouveau_create_buffer()
|
D | nouveau_screen.h | 35 __DRIscreen *dri_screen;
|
/third_party/mesa3d/src/mesa/drivers/dri/i915/ |
D | intel_screen.c | 319 intel_create_image_from_name(__DRIscreen *screen, in intel_create_image_from_name() 448 intel_create_image(__DRIscreen *screen, in intel_create_image() 565 intel_create_image_from_names(__DRIscreen *screen, in intel_create_image_from_names() 606 intel_create_image_from_fds(__DRIscreen *screen, in intel_create_image_from_fds() 728 i915_query_renderer_integer(__DRIscreen *psp, int param, unsigned int *value) in i915_query_renderer_integer() 785 i915_query_renderer_string(__DRIscreen *psp, int param, const char **value) in i915_query_renderer_string() 823 intel_get_param(__DRIscreen *psp, int param, int *value) in intel_get_param() 843 intel_get_boolean(__DRIscreen *psp, int param) in intel_get_boolean() 850 intelDestroyScreen(__DRIscreen * sPriv) in intelDestroyScreen() 866 intelCreateBuffer(__DRIscreen * driScrnPriv, in intelCreateBuffer() [all …]
|
D | intel_context.c | 112 __DRIscreen *const screen = intel->intelScreen->driScrnPriv; in intel_flush_front() 201 __DRIscreen *screen = intel->intelScreen->driScrnPriv; in intel_update_renderbuffers() 416 __DRIscreen *sPriv = driContextPriv->driScreenPriv; in intelInitContext() 684 __DRIscreen *screen = intel->intelScreen->driScrnPriv; in intel_query_dri2_buffers() 845 __DRIscreen *screen = intel->intelScreen->driScrnPriv; in intel_update_image_buffers()
|
/third_party/mesa3d/src/mesa/drivers/dri/r200/ |
D | radeon_screen.c | 147 radeonGetParam(__DRIscreen *sPriv, int param, void *value) in radeonGetParam() 206 radeon_create_image_from_name(__DRIscreen *screen, in radeon_create_image_from_name() 306 radeon_create_image(__DRIscreen *screen, in radeon_create_image() 485 radeonQueryRendererInteger(__DRIscreen *psp, int param, in radeonQueryRendererInteger() 528 radeonQueryRendererString(__DRIscreen *psp, int param, const char **value) in radeonQueryRendererString() 567 radeonCreateScreen2(__DRIscreen *sPriv) in radeonCreateScreen2() 621 radeonDestroyScreen( __DRIscreen *sPriv ) in radeonDestroyScreen() 644 radeonInitDriver( __DRIscreen *sPriv ) in radeonInitDriver() 664 radeonCreateBuffer( __DRIscreen *driScrnPriv, in radeonCreateBuffer() 798 __DRIconfig **radeonInitScreen2(__DRIscreen *psp) in radeonInitScreen2()
|
/third_party/mesa3d/src/mesa/drivers/dri/radeon/ |
D | radeon_screen.c | 147 radeonGetParam(__DRIscreen *sPriv, int param, void *value) in radeonGetParam() 206 radeon_create_image_from_name(__DRIscreen *screen, in radeon_create_image_from_name() 306 radeon_create_image(__DRIscreen *screen, in radeon_create_image() 485 radeonQueryRendererInteger(__DRIscreen *psp, int param, in radeonQueryRendererInteger() 528 radeonQueryRendererString(__DRIscreen *psp, int param, const char **value) in radeonQueryRendererString() 567 radeonCreateScreen2(__DRIscreen *sPriv) in radeonCreateScreen2() 621 radeonDestroyScreen( __DRIscreen *sPriv ) in radeonDestroyScreen() 644 radeonInitDriver( __DRIscreen *sPriv ) in radeonInitDriver() 664 radeonCreateBuffer( __DRIscreen *driScrnPriv, in radeonCreateBuffer() 798 __DRIconfig **radeonInitScreen2(__DRIscreen *psp) in radeonInitScreen2()
|
/third_party/mesa3d/src/mesa/drivers/dri/i965/ |
D | brw_screen.c | 520 brw_create_image_from_name(__DRIscreen *dri_screen, in brw_create_image_from_name() 660 const __DRIscreen * driScreen = image->driScrnPriv; in brw_destroy_image() 728 brw_create_image_common(__DRIscreen *dri_screen, in brw_create_image_common() 838 brw_create_image(__DRIscreen *dri_screen, in brw_create_image() 910 brw_create_image_with_modifiers(__DRIscreen *dri_screen, in brw_create_image_with_modifiers() 921 brw_create_image_with_modifiers2(__DRIscreen *dri_screen, in brw_create_image_with_modifiers2() 939 __DRIscreen *dri_screen = image->screen->driScrnPriv; in brw_query_image() 994 brw_query_format_modifier_attribs(__DRIscreen *dri_screen, in brw_query_format_modifier_attribs() 1061 brw_create_image_from_names(__DRIscreen *dri_screen, in brw_create_image_from_names() 1097 brw_create_image_from_fds_common(__DRIscreen *dri_screen, in brw_create_image_from_fds_common() [all …]
|
/third_party/mesa3d/src/glx/ |
D | dri3_priv.h | 89 __DRIscreen *driScreen; 96 __DRIscreen *driScreenDisplayGPU;
|
D | drisw_priv.h | 47 __DRIscreen *driScreen;
|
D | dri2_priv.h | 43 __DRIscreen *driScreen;
|
/third_party/mesa3d/src/gbm/backends/dri/ |
D | gbm_driint.h | 68 __DRIscreen *screen; 83 __DRIimage *(*lookup_image)(__DRIscreen *screen, void *image, void *data);
|
/third_party/mesa3d/src/glx/tests/ |
D | query_renderer_implementation_unittest.cpp | 77 fake_queryInteger(__DRIscreen *screen, int attribute, unsigned int *val) in fake_queryInteger() 124 fake_queryString(__DRIscreen *screen, int attribute, const char **val) in fake_queryString()
|